Honda NC750X: The Overlooked DCT Motorcycle with Innovative Design and Car-Inspired Engineering
The NC750X exclusively uses Honda's Dual Clutch Transmission (DCT), a six-speed automatic that's been refined since 2007. Unlike manual transmissions on most bikes, DCT shifts seamlessly without a clutch lever, making it ideal for beginners or traffic-heavy commutes. It drives power to a 160-section rear tire via chain, keeping replacement costs reasonable. 80,000 Unsold Harley-Davidson Motorcycles: The 2026 Inventory Crisis Explained
The buildup happened for three main reasons. First, after the strong 2020-2021 pandemic sales spike, Harley projected permanent growth and ramped up production. Dealers ordered more bikes 12 to 18 months in advance, but demand returned to pre-pandemic levels by 2023 and kept falling. Unlocking the Secrets of Motorcycle Counter-Steering
Ever hopped on a motorcycle and wondered why pushing the handlebar left makes you turn right? That's counter-steering in action—a core skill that feels backward at first but keeps you balanced and alive on the road. At speeds above about 16 km/h (10 mph), this technique initiates your lean, letting the bike carve corners like a pro.
